What is the difference between Disaster Case Manager vs Social Worker?
| Disaster Case Manager | Social Worker |
|---|---|
| Typically requires certifications like CPR, disaster response training, and sometimes a bachelor's degree in social work or related field | Usually requires a bachelor's or master's degree in social work or related field, along with state licensure |
| Works primarily in disaster zones, emergency response settings, or community recovery programs | Works in various settings including hospitals, schools, community agencies, and government offices |
| Focuses on disaster-related needs, recovery planning, and resource coordination | Addresses a broad range of social, emotional, and practical needs of clients |
While both roles involve supporting individuals in crisis, Disaster Case Managers specialize in disaster response and recovery, often working in emergency settings, whereas Social Workers have a broader scope, addressing diverse social issues across multiple environments.

Position Title: High School Assistant Principal FLSA Status: Exempt
Responsible to: Building Principal Supervises: Students
Evaluated by: Building Principal in accordance to Board Policy Terms of Employment: 225 days
Evaluation Period:
- Formative evaluations throughout the school year as per MCS Performance and Assessment procedure
- Annual summative evaluation prior to July 1
Purpose of the Position: Assist in overall building supervision, test coordination, school improvement committee, teacher evaluation, master schedule, and teacher walk through observations and discipline
Classified as Confidential Employee: Functional responsibilities or knowledge in connection with the issues involved in dealings between the school corporation and its employees require strict adherence to confidentiality.
Minimum Requirements: The following qualifications represent the minimum requirements necessary for an individual to perform this position effectively.
- Certification for secondary school administration and supervision
- Proven ability to provide leadership at the high school level
- Knowledge and skill in the application of all statutes, rules, regulations, case law, and school corporation policies affecting the enrollment, attendance, and supervision of Marion High School
Essential Functions of the Position: The following functions have been determined by Marion Community Schools to be essential to the successful performance of this position.
- Serve as principal when the principal is absent from the building.
- Assist the principal in the overall administration of the school.
- Assist the principal in providing in-service training for the staff.
- Assist with teacher/staff evaluation as directed by the principal.
- Assist the principal in overseeing the processes leading to curriculum revision.
- Assist the principal with supervision of students, including athletic and social events as assigned by the principal and during lunchroom, arrival, and dismissal.
- Represent the administration during conferences with counselors, pupils, parents, and teachers.
- Represent the administration in 504 and special education conferences.
- Meet with relevant staff members to provide assistance regarding student-related concerns (discipline, academic, attendance).
- Contact Child Protective Services (Welfare), Grant County Juvenile, and Grant County law enforcement when appropriate.
- Assist the principal in conducting orientation and parent open forums.
- Assist the principal in planning and conducting the Parent Open House and Parent Teacher Conferences.
- Assist the principal in acclimating student teachers and interns to the building.
- Assist in the preparation of teacher handbooks.
- Assist the athletic department on special projects as needed.
- Assist with the disaster plans and completing disaster reports.
- Coordinate teacher supervisory and teacher assistant daily assignment schedules.
- Attend the high school academic meetings.
- Attend MPO meetings when appropriate.
Secondary Functions of the Position: The following functions, while important and necessary to the position, have been determined by Marion Community Schools to be marginal to the successful performance of this position.
- Assist support staff as needed (i.e. custodian, nurse, secretary, etc.).
- Supervise extracurricular activities.
- Other duties as assigned by the Principal or Superintendent.
Knowledge of:
- Policies, procedures and functions of student management practices
- Applicable software and applications
- Teaching methodologies to provide assistance to teachers requiring instructional assistance at the high school level
Ability to:
- Use the school corporation secondary teacher evaluation system, including observation, report preparation, and conferences.
- Plan, organize, and schedule priorities.
- Use independent judgment and initiative in making sound decisions and in developing solutions to problems.
- Discreetly handle confidential and politically sensitive matters.
- Make independent decisions in accordance with established policies and procedures.
- Tactfully and courteously respond to requests and inquiries/complaints from the general public and staff.
- Communicate clearly and concisely, both orally and in writing.
- Establish and maintain effective working relationships with students, staff and the community.
Equipment Used:
- General Office Equipment (computer, telephone, copier, fax machine)
Place Where Work is Performed:
- Throughout the school building
Physical Demands:
- Must be able to sit and/or stand for long periods of time.
- Must be able to stoop, kneel or crouch.
- Must be able to hear and speak clearly.
- Must be able to lift items of 20 lbs. occasionally.
